Building a turbulence-transport workflow incorporating uncertainty quantification for predicting core profiles in a tokamak plasma

摘要
The impact of micro-scale turbulence on the macro-scale plasma profiles in a tokamak is a multi-scale problem (both in space and time) that is treated in this paper by the coupling of turbulence simulations of multiple flux-tubes to a core transport code, together with an equilibrium code. Work on quantifying the uncertainty in the predicted profiles, together with a comparison to experiment is also presented.
